What is the digital signature legality for technical support in the European Union
The digital signature legality for technical support in the European Union is governed by the eIDAS Regulation, which establishes a legal framework for electronic signatures. This regulation ensures that digital signatures have the same legal standing as handwritten signatures, thereby facilitating secure and efficient electronic transactions. In the context of technical support, digital signatures can be used to authenticate documents, agreements, and communications, ensuring both parties are protected and that the integrity of the documents is maintained.

Security & Compliance Guidelines
When using digital signatures, it is essential to adhere to security and compliance guidelines to protect sensitive information. Ensure that the digital signature platform complies with eIDAS and other relevant regulations. Use strong authentication methods, such as two-factor authentication, to verify the identity of signers. Additionally, maintain an audit trail of all signed documents, which provides a record of actions taken during the signing process and can be crucial for legal purposes.

Digital vs. Paper-Based Signing
Digital signing offers several advantages over traditional paper-based methods. It streamlines the signing process, reducing the time required to obtain signatures. Digital signatures also enhance security, as they include encryption and authentication features that paper signatures lack. Furthermore, digital documents are easier to store, manage, and retrieve, contributing to improved efficiency in technical support workflows. By transitioning to digital signatures, organizations can reduce their environmental impact and operational costs associated with paper handling.
